New Beginings Center

Organization Overview

New Beginings Center is located in Nashville, TN. The organization was established in 2011. According to its NTEE Classification (E60) the organization is classified as: Health Support, under the broad grouping of Health Care and related organizations. As of 06/2021, New Beginings Center employed 12 individuals. This organization is an independent organization and not affiliated with a larger national or regional group of organizations. New Beginings Center is a 501(c)(3) and as such, is described as a "Charitable or Religous organization or a private foundation" by the IRS.

For the year ending 06/2021, New Beginings Center generated $438.3k in total revenue. This represents relatively stable growth, over the past 7 years the organization has increased revenue by an average of 4.4% each year. All expenses for the organization totaled $414.6k during the year ending 06/2021. While expenses have increased by 4.2% per year over the past 7 years. They've been increasing with an increasing level of total revenue. You can explore the organizations financials more deeply in the financial statements section below.

Describe the Organization's Program Activity:

Part 3 - Line 4a

THE NEW BEGINNINGS CENTER (TNBC) SECURED FUNDING FROM OVER 13 FOUNDATIONS, 20 CORPORATIONS AND HUNDREDS OF INDIVIDUALS. WE WILL CONTINUE TO GROW OUR DONOR BASE BY DEMONSTRATING SUSTAINABLE WELLNESS RESULTS THROUGH OUR CLIENTS. IT IS OUR MISSION TO IMPROVE THE OBESITY STATISTICS IN NASHVILLE BY OFFERING WOMEN A HOLISTIC AND INDIVIDUALIZED APPROACH TO DEVELOPING HEALTHY LIFESTYLES. WE OFFER AT-RISK WOMEN GROUP WELLNESS EDUCATION CLASSES THAT WILL COVER A VARIETY OF TOPICS INCLUDING NUTRITION EDUCATION AND COOKING, ACCESS TO COMMUNITY WELLNESS FACILITIES, SELF ACTUALIZATION AND BEHAVIOR MODIFICATION CLASSES, ETC. THESE CLASSES ARE FOCUSED ON COACHING WOMEN IN THEIR JOURNEY TO BUILD A HEALTHY BODY AND IMPROVED QUALITY OF LIFE. TNBC PROVIDED THOUSANDS OF HOURS OF SERVICE TO 502 WOMEN IN THE 2020-2021 FISCAL YEAR. THE WOMEN PARTICIPATE IN A 12 MONTH FITNESS, NUTRITION, AND LIFESTYLE COACHING PROGRAM WHERE THEY MEET 2 TO 3 TIMES A WEEK FOR HOUR LONG COACHING SESSIONS. THESE WOMEN HAVE LOST 7% BODY WEIGHT, AND ARE MAINTAINING THEIR WEIGHT LOSS. THEY HAVE ALSO ACHIEVED THE FOLLOWING RESULTS ON AVERAGE: 7% BMI REDUCTION, MORE THAN 40% HAVE STOPPED OR DECREASED THE AMOUNT OF PRESCRIPTION MEDICATION FOR OBESITY RELATED DISEASE, 100% HAVE TESTED IMPROVED CONFIDENCE AND SELF CONCEPT, 94% HAVE TESTED IMPROVED KNOWLEDGE OF NUTRITIONAL CONCEPTS, 95% OF CLIENTS REPORT A POSTIIVE INFLUENCE ON THEIR FAMILY AND FRIENDS AS A RESULT OF WHAT THEY HAVE LEARNED IN OUR PROGRAMS, AND 100% OF GRADUATE CLIENTS HAVE IMPROVED STRENGTH AND MOBILITY. THE VOLUNTEER HOURS HAVE EXCEEDED 6,000 HOURS AND IS GROWING. THE SAME SUCCESS RATES HAVE BEEN REPORTED THROUGHOUT THE ENTIRITY OF THE COVID-19 PANDEMIC AS TNBC OFFERED VIRTUAL PROGRAMMING. TNBC HAS RECEIVED SUPPORT FROM NUMEROUS NEW FOUNDATIONS AND CORPORATION DONORS. COLLABORATION PARTNERS HAVE GROWN AS WELL AND WE ARE WORKING WITH MANY NON-PROFIT AND LOCAL GOVERNMENT EMPLOYEE GROUPS WHO RECOMMEND CLIENTS FOR OUR PROGRAMS.
